全國重金屬高污染潛勢農地之管制及調查計畫

中文摘要 本計畫透過系統性思維,研擬出重金屬高污染潛勢農地之篩選方法,再以現有本署土壤調查結果及本計畫中試辦區土壤調查結果驗證此方法之可行性。由此,政府對於臺灣農地土壤之掌控會更接近現況,並能有效率的全面掌控最新動向。 在本計畫執行過程中,所完成之成果包含下列5 大項: (一)高污染潛勢農地之篩選:本計畫依內梅羅綜合指標法進行評估,其中,危害等級及污染等級所占比率雖僅有全國農地之2.65%,但所占面積仍有1.5萬公頃,有其需調查或整治之迫切性。 (二)試辦區調查:本計畫試辦區調查驗證高污染潛勢農地篩選方法之正確性,因此上述1.5 萬公頃之高污染潛勢農地建議可辦理後續擴大調查、監測或管制作業。 (三)建置農地重金屬污染潛勢評量與預警管制系統:蒐集各部會農地土壤相關資訊,建置首座農地系統。系統功能除資料查找外,更運用地理資訊系統之概念,整合資料與圖資的關係,並成為各部會交流之平臺,將農地資訊發揮最大效益並成為重要的里程碑。 (四)土壤污染管制標準之研議:檢討現行土壤污染管制標準及監測標準,研擬適合我國修訂土壤污染管制標準及監測標準之方案。研議結果:依據國內外相關研究,修訂及增訂重金屬、含氯有機化合物、油品類及火炸藥類等建議項目。 (五)推動方案:針對現行農地概況、管制及行政方式編撰「農地污染之改善與預防推動方案」,提供貴署後續辦理農地相關事宜及協商之方向。

Control and Investigation Program for National Agricultural Land with High Potential of Heavy Metal

英文摘要 The aim of this project was to develop screening method of high potential of heavy metals pollution agricultural land using systematic thinking, then use EPA history soil survey data and real soil survey in the demonstrate area to verify the feasibility of this method. Therefore, the government will be able to make decisions related to controlling the soil pollution incidents based on the most up to date information. This project has five major contributions, as follows: (1) Development an appropriate screening process investigated the heavy-metal contamination of agricultural land and identified the potential area. About 2.65% (15,000 hectares) of agricultural land in Taiwan, according to Nemerow index method, was rating as hazard level requires urgent investigation and remediation. (2) Investigation of soil and water environmental (such as drainage, rivers, etc.) in the demonstrate area chosen by the screening results, one of the high potential pollution agricultural land. In order to perform follow-up demonstration to the investigation plan, monitoring plan and pollution control work. (3) Building a system for potential assessment and early warning control of heavy metal contamination of agricultural land. Collect related information from different ministries and departments, and build the first agricultural land management system. In addition find more use of the concept of geographic information systems, the system also have functions based on the integration of the relationship between data and spatial data, and ministries will share the infromation platform for agricultural land information to maximize the benefits and become an important milestone. (4) Deliberation of the Taiwan soil pollution control standards and soil pollution monitoring standards revise it based on the related study from local and other countries. (5) Writing an implementation plan to improve pollution control and prevention in agricultural land work provide Taiwan EPA the guidelines of this work.
